How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bowling Green?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bowling Green Studio Apartments | $1,577 | $1,468 | $1,670 |
| Bowling Green 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,835 | $1,041 | $3,872 |
| Bowling Green 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,181 | $1,241 | $5,741 |
| Bowling Green 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,615 | $1,799 | $4,087 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
